Every residence is physically inspected, document-verified, and professionally photographed by Le'elt's atelier before publication.
The House Standard is Le'elt's editorial publication standard. Every published residence has passed Le'elt's review for photography, accuracy and completeness before it appears on the platform.
Inspected by Le'elt is the staff-observed evidence layer — landmarks, street class, drive times, nearby places and architectural orientation, recorded by Le'elt staff on the inspection visit.
A Residence Record is the permanent public reference number assigned to every published residence on Le'elt, in the format BO-XXXXXX.
Le'elt Hold routes tenant and buyer funds through Le'elt's custody account. Hosts are never paid directly; funds release only after physical verification and contract execution.
A Verified Host is a host whose identity documents, phone connectivity and property assignment rights have been manually authenticated by Le'elt staff.
